🗒️ Editorial Note: This article was composed by AI. As always, we recommend referring to authoritative, official sources for verification of critical information.
Cybersecurity laws related to software development have become essential frameworks guiding industry practices and legal responsibilities. As technology advances, understanding these laws is crucial for ensuring compliance and safeguarding digital assets.
With increasing cyber threats and evolving regulations, developers must navigate complex legal landscapes that shield data privacy, establish security standards, and define penalties for breaches. How can software professionals stay ahead in this evolving legal environment?
Understanding Cybersecurity Laws and Their Relevance to Software Development
Cybersecurity laws are a collection of legal frameworks designed to protect digital information and infrastructure from cyber threats. These laws regulate various aspects of digital security, emphasizing the importance of data integrity, confidentiality, and system resilience.
For software development, understanding cybersecurity laws is vital because they establish legal expectations and obligations regarding security measures. Developers must ensure their software complies with these laws to mitigate legal risks and avoid penalties.
Compliance involves implementing security practices mandated by laws such as data breach protocols, privacy protections, and security standards. Awareness of these legal requirements helps developers create more secure software, aligning technical practices with legal standards.
In essence, awareness and adherence to cybersecurity laws related to software development are fundamental to safeguarding user data and maintaining trust, while also fulfilling legal responsibilities in an increasingly digital world.
Key Regulations Influencing Software Security Practices
Several regulations significantly influence software security practices within the framework of cybersecurity law. Notably, the General Data Protection Regulation (GDPR) establishes strict data protection and privacy standards for software developers handling personal information of EU residents. Compliance with GDPR mandates implementing robust security controls to prevent data breaches and protect user data integrity.
The California Consumer Privacy Act (CCPA) similarly impacts software development by requiring transparency in data collection and offering consumers rights related to their personal information. Developers must incorporate mechanisms to ensure data privacy compliance, shaping security design choices.
Additionally, industry-specific standards, such as the Payment Card Industry Data Security Standard (PCI DSS), set requirements for protecting payment card data. These standards influence software development practices, especially for companies involved in e-commerce or financial transactions, by emphasizing encryption and access controls.
Understanding these key regulations helps developers embed security practices that align with legal obligations, reducing risks of violations and enhancing overall software security resilience.
Data Protection and Privacy Obligations for Developers
Data protection and privacy obligations for developers are fundamental components of cybersecurity law that govern how personal data must be collected, processed, and stored. Developers are responsible for implementing privacy-by-design principles to ensure sensitive information remains secure from inception. Adherence to regulations such as GDPR and CCPA necessitates that developers incorporate technical measures like encryption, access controls, and secure data transmission.
These obligations also include minimizing data collection to only what is necessary and securing user consent where required. Failure to comply may result in severe legal consequences, including fines or sanctions, emphasizing the importance of embedding privacy practices within the development lifecycle. Developers should stay informed of evolving legal standards to maintain compliance and foster user trust in their software solutions.
Understanding and applying these data protection and privacy obligations uphold legal standards and enhance the security posture of software products, aligning development practices with current cybersecurity laws.
Security Standards and Frameworks in Cybersecurity Laws
Security standards and frameworks in cybersecurity laws establish structured guidelines to ensure software development adheres to best security practices. They serve as benchmarks for implementing effective security controls and reducing vulnerability risks. Adherence to these standards helps organizations demonstrate legal compliance and enhances trustworthiness.
Key frameworks commonly referenced include the NIST Cybersecurity Framework, ISO/IEC 27001, and the OWASP Top Ten. These standards offer defined processes for risk management, security controls, and testing protocols. Regulatory environments often mandate their integration into software development lifecycle processes.
Implementing these frameworks typically involves a step-by-step approach, including risk assessment, security planning, control implementation, and continuous monitoring. It is vital for developers to understand these frameworks, as they influence legal requirements and promote proactive security measures. Failing to comply can lead to legal penalties and reputational damage, highlighting the importance of aligning with these security standards in cybersecurity law.
Legal Responsibilities for Software Developers in Incident Response
In the context of cybersecurity law, software developers have a legal obligation to participate in incident response processes effectively. This includes promptly addressing security breaches, minimizing damage, and preventing further exploitation of vulnerabilities. Developers must be prepared to modify or patch software swiftly to mitigate ongoing threats.
Legal responsibilities also encompass timely communication with relevant authorities and affected stakeholders. Developers are often required to report data breaches within stipulated timeframes under applicable regulations. Failure to do so can lead to substantial penalties, emphasizing the importance of adherence to incident reporting obligations.
Moreover, cybersecurity laws increasingly hold developers accountable for documenting and maintaining detailed records of security incidents. This documentation aids investigations and demonstrates compliance with legal standards. Non-compliance or negligence in incident response can result in sanctions, legal liabilities, or reputational damage, underscoring the vital role of legal accountability in software security.
Obligations to Report Data Breaches
Obligations to report data breaches are a fundamental component of cybersecurity laws related to software development, emphasizing transparency and accountability. Laws typically require organizations to notify affected individuals promptly if their personal data has been compromised.
Failure to report such incidents within stipulated deadlines can result in significant legal penalties, including fines and sanctions. These obligations aim to mitigate further harm, enable affected users to take protective measures, and uphold trust in digital services.
Developers and organizations must establish clear breach response procedures aligned with relevant regulations to ensure swift and effective reporting. Non-compliance not only leads to legal repercussions but can also damage organizational reputation and stakeholder confidence.
Penalties for Non-Compliance and Security Failures
Non-compliance with cybersecurity laws related to software development can lead to significant penalties, including legal and financial repercussions. Regulatory bodies may impose sanctions like hefty fines, license revocations, or operational restrictions on offending organizations. These penalties aim to enforce adherence and protect user data.
Violations may also trigger civil lawsuits from affected parties, resulting in substantial damages claims. In some jurisdictions, criminal charges may be pursued against responsible individuals, leading to fines or imprisonment. The severity of penalties often correlates with the breach’s scope and impact.
Key penalties for security failures include:
- Financial fines, potentially reaching billions of dollars depending on the law and violation severity.
- Mandatory audits and remediation measures to address security deficiencies.
- Increased regulatory scrutiny and ongoing compliance obligations.
- Reputational damage that can diminish customer trust and business opportunities.
Organizations involved in software development should understand these penalties to ensure legal compliance and mitigate risks associated with cybersecurity law violations.
Cybercrime Laws Impacting Software Development
Cybercrime laws significantly influence software development by establishing legal boundaries against malicious activities such as hacking, data theft, and malware dissemination. Developers must ensure their software does not facilitate or unintentionally support cybercriminal actions, aligning compliance with these laws.
Compliance requires awareness of legislation such as the Computer Fraud and Abuse Act (CFAA) in the United States or the Computer Misuse Act in the UK. These laws criminalize unauthorized access and impose penalties for violating security protocols, prompting developers to incorporate robust security measures.
Moreover, cybercrime laws impact the design of security features, emphasizing the necessity for secure coding practices and vulnerability mitigation. Non-compliance may lead to legal sanctions, financial penalties, and reputational damage, highlighting the importance of adhering to cybercrime laws in all phases of software development.
Cross-Border Data Transfer Restrictions and Their Effect on Software
Cross-border data transfer restrictions refer to legal limitations imposed on the movement of data across national borders, primarily to protect personal privacy and national security. These restrictions significantly influence how software handles international data flows.
Many countries enforce strict data localization laws requiring certain data types to remain within their borders, impacting global software deployment. Developers must ensure compliance with these regulations to avoid legal penalties and operational disruptions.
International laws and agreements, such as the European Union’s General Data Protection Regulation (GDPR) and the US Cloud Act, establish frameworks for lawful cross-border data transfers. Compliance strategies involve implementing standard contractual clauses and data transfer mechanisms aligned with these regulations.
Failure to adhere to cross-border data transfer restrictions can lead to severe legal consequences, including fines and reputational damage. Therefore, software solutions intended for a global audience must incorporate robust compliance measures respecting these legal boundaries.
International Laws and Agreements
International laws and agreements significantly influence cybersecurity laws related to software development by establishing frameworks for cross-border data transfer and cooperation. These legal mechanisms facilitate or restrict the flow of data across countries, impacting global software solutions.
Agreements such as the General Data Protection Regulation (GDPR) in the European Union set stringent standards for data privacy and security, requiring developers to incorporate compliance measures when handling international data. Similar treaties, like the Cloud Computing Act or the Budapest Convention, promote international cooperation in tackling cybercrime and enhancing cybersecurity practices.
However, differences among national laws present compliance challenges for software developers working across jurisdictions. Companies must navigate a complex landscape of varied standards and legal requirements, often adopting a unified security strategy aligned with the strictest applicable laws.
Staying current with international legal developments is crucial, as new agreements frequently emerge to address evolving cybersecurity threats. Developers can mitigate legal risks by integrating compliance strategies that respect cross-border data transfer restrictions and international cybersecurity obligations.
Compliance Strategies for Global Software Solutions
When addressing compliance strategies for global software solutions, organizations must develop a comprehensive approach to meet varying cybersecurity laws and regulations across jurisdictions. Implementing a unified compliance framework ensures consistency and reduces legal risks.
To effectively manage compliance, companies should conduct detailed legal assessments for each target market. This involves identifying applicable data protection laws, cybersecurity standards, and cross-border data transfer restrictions. Understanding these aspects helps tailor security practices accordingly.
Key steps include establishing clear policies for data handling, implementing international data transfer agreements, and regularly updating practices to reflect evolving legal standards. Maintaining thorough documentation of compliance efforts is also vital for audits and legal accountability.
Organizations should consider adopting standardized security frameworks, such as ISO/IEC 27001, which align with many legal requirements and facilitate international compliance. Regular training and audits help ensure all teams understand and adhere to these evolving legal obligations.
Ethical and Legal Considerations in Software Security Testing
Ethical and legal considerations in software security testing are fundamental to maintaining trust and legal compliance. Testers must ensure their activities do not infringe on user privacy or violate data protection laws. Unauthorized testing can lead to legal liabilities or criminal charges.
Adherence to established legal frameworks, such as the Computer Fraud and Abuse Act (CFAA) in the U.S. or the General Data Protection Regulation (GDPR) in Europe, is essential. These laws restrict testing without explicit consent from system owners. Failing to obtain proper authorization risks legal penalties and reputational damage.
Moreover, it is vital for developers and testers to follow industry standards and best practices. Ethical testing involves minimizing harm, avoiding data misuse, and reporting vulnerabilities responsibly. Transparency and accountability promote compliance with cybersecurity laws related to software development.
In summary, navigating the ethical and legal landscape of software security testing ensures lawful engagement and upholds professional integrity. Recognizing these considerations supports sustainable software development practices aligned with cybersecurity law.
Emerging Trends and Future Legal Developments in Cybersecurity Law
Emerging trends in cybersecurity law are focusing on regulating new technological advancements such as cloud computing and artificial intelligence (AI). Legislation is increasingly addressing the unique security risks associated with these innovations, aiming to establish clear legal standards for compliance.
Future legal developments are also anticipated to tackle the growing challenges of safeguarding data in a highly interconnected global landscape. Laws surrounding cross-border data transfer restrictions are expected to become more stringent, requiring organizations to adopt comprehensive compliance strategies.
Additionally, governments are beginning to introduce regulations specifically targeting AI and cloud security, emphasizing accountability, transparency, and ethical use. These new frameworks will shape how software developers implement security measures and ensure regulatory adherence.
Legal challenges related to emerging technologies are likely to evolve rapidly, requiring ongoing adaptation by software developers and organizations. Staying informed and proactive in complying with future cybersecurity laws will be essential to mitigate risks and maintain trust in digital services.
New Legislation on Cloud Security and AI Software
Recent legislative developments increasingly address cloud security and AI software, reflecting the growing importance of these technologies in software development. These laws aim to establish clear standards for data protection, system integrity, and user privacy within cloud environments utilizing AI. They often emphasize the need for developers to implement robust security measures to prevent cyberattacks and data breaches.
Specific regulations may mandate transparency in AI decision-making processes and require secure data handling practices for cloud-based applications. Additionally, legislation may impose reporting obligations if a security incident involves AI or cloud systems, emphasizing accountability and prompt response. These new laws also foster international cooperation, as cloud and AI solutions typically cross borders, necessitating compliance with multiple legal frameworks.
Compliance strategies involve adopting standardized security frameworks, conducting regular audits, and ensuring AI algorithms are explainable and auditable. Navigating these emerging legal requirements is crucial for software developers to mitigate legal risks and maintain user trust. Overall, the evolving legislation underscores the increasing intersection of law, cloud security, and AI in software development.
Anticipated Legal Challenges for Software Developers
Navigating future legal challenges in software development requires careful attention to evolving cybersecurity laws. As legislation on cloud security and AI software becomes more comprehensive, developers must adapt to stricter compliance requirements. These new laws may impose additional responsibilities and documentation obligations, increasing operational complexity.
Emerging legal issues may also involve liability concerns related to AI decision-making transparency and accountability. Developers could face legal scrutiny if AI systems unintentionally cause harm or violate privacy regulations. Staying informed about changes in legislation is crucial to mitigate legal risks effectively.
Cross-border data transfer restrictions are expected to become more stringent, complicating international software deployment. Compliance with diverse legal frameworks, such as the GDPR or new regional laws, will present ongoing challenges. Developers must implement robust legal strategies for data sovereignty and international compliance to avoid penalties.
Finally, legal frameworks addressing emerging technologies like blockchain, IoT, and quantum computing are still under development. As these areas evolve, developers must anticipate potential legal liabilities and adapt risk management practices accordingly. Proactive legal planning is essential for ensuring sustainable compliance in the future landscape of cybersecurity law.
Navigating Cybersecurity Laws: Best Practices for Legal Compliance
To effectively navigate cybersecurity laws and achieve legal compliance, software developers should prioritize establishing comprehensive internal policies aligned with applicable regulations. Regular training ensures teams understand evolving legal requirements and best practices. This proactive approach helps mitigate the risk of violations related to data protection, incident reporting, and security standards.
Maintaining meticulous documentation of security measures, incident response protocols, and compliance efforts is critical. Such records not only demonstrate adherence during audits but also facilitate transparency with regulatory authorities. Developers should also stay informed about updates in cybersecurity laws, including emerging legislation targeting cloud security and AI software.
Engaging legal professionals specializing in cybersecurity law can provide tailored guidance for specific jurisdictions and sectors. Additionally, integrating compliance with recognized security frameworks, such as ISO/IEC 27001 or NIST standards, enhances overall security posture and legal alignment. Following these best practices helps software developers manage legal risks while fostering trust with users and stakeholders.